Pyrophanite
      Mitchell R H, Liferovich R P
      The Canadian Mineralogist 42 (2004) 1871-1880
      The pyrophanite-ecandrewsite solid-solution: crystal structures
      of the Mn1-xZnxSiO3 series (0.1 <= x <= 0.8)
      Sample: x = .3, ilmenite structure
      _database_code_amcsd 0005997

      CELL PARAMETERS:    5.1189   5.1189  14.1741   90.000   90.000  120.000
      SPACE GROUP: R-3       
      X-RAY WAVELENGTH:     1.541838
      Cell Volume:    321.649
      Density (g/cm3):      4.768
      MAX. ABS. INTENSITY / VOLUME**2:      48.67153762    
      RIR:      3.324
      RIR based on corundum from Acta Crystallographica A38 (1982) 733-739
